ما هي أدوات تطوير الويب المتاحة عبر الإنترنت مجانًا

نشرت: 2022-04-28

تخيل مدى صعوبة تطوير موقع ويب إذا لم تكن هناك أدوات تطوير ويب. كانت البرمجة أكثر تعقيدًا وسيواجه المطورون موقفًا لكتابة الرموز في كثير من الأحيان أكثر من إعادة استخدام الرموز الحالية لتطوير جديد. لحسن الحظ ، مع أدوات ترميز تطوير الويب السبعة هذه ، يمكن للمبرمجين تطوير مواقع الويب بمزيد من السهولة والمرونة.
إليك أفضل 7 أدوات تطوير ويب مجانية مذهلة في عام 2020

الزاوي. شبيبة

AngularJS هو إطار هيكلي لتطبيقات الويب الديناميكية. يتيح لك استخدام HTML كلغة نموذجك ويسمح لك بتوسيع بنية HTML للتعبير عن مكونات التطبيق الخاص بك بوضوح وإيجاز. يؤدي ربط البيانات وإدخال التبعية في AngularJS إلى التخلص من الكثير من التعليمات البرمجية التي قد يتعين عليك كتابتها بخلاف ذلك. وكل ذلك يحدث داخل المتصفح ، مما يجعله شريكًا مثاليًا مع أي تقنية خادم. تقدم AngularJS التطوير عبر جميع الأنظمة الأساسية والسرعة والأداء من خلال وظائف الأدوات المذهلة.

Chrome DevTools

Chrome DevTools عبارة عن مجموعة من أدوات مطوري الويب المضمنة مباشرة في متصفح Google Chrome. يمكن أن تساعدك DevTools في تحرير الصفحات أثناء التنقل وتشخيص المشكلات بسرعة ، مما يساعدك في النهاية على إنشاء مواقع ويب أفضل بشكل أسرع. لديه وظيفة لعرض وتغيير DOM ونمط الصفحة ، وله وظائف مختلفة للوحات الأمان مثل فهم مشكلات الأمان ولوحة التطبيقات ولوحة الذاكرة ولوحة الشبكة ولوحة المصادر ولوحة وحدة التحكم ولوحة العناصر ووضع الجهاز .

ساس

Sass (التي تعني "أوراق أنماط رائعة نحويًا) هي امتداد لـ CSS يمكنك من استخدام أشياء مثل المتغيرات والقواعد المتداخلة وعمليات الاستيراد المضمنة والمزيد. يساعد أيضًا في الحفاظ على الأشياء منظمة ويسمح لك بإنشاء أوراق أنماط بشكل أسرع.
يتوافق Sass مع جميع إصدارات CSS. الشرط الوحيد لاستخدامه هو أنه يجب تثبيت Ruby. Sass متوافق مع CSS ويمكنك مع Sass - تنظيم أوراق أنماط كبيرة واستخدام ميزاته مثل التعشيش والمتغيرات والحلقات والحجج وما إلى ذلك.

الناخر

Grunt هو عداء مهام JavaScript ، وهو أداة تستخدم تلقائيًا لأداء المهام المتكررة مثل التصغير والتجميع واختبار الوحدة والفحص. يستخدم واجهة سطر أوامر لتشغيل مهام مخصصة محددة في ملف. Grunt من توقيع Ben Alman وكُتب في Node.js. يتم توزيعه عبر NPM.
فوائد استخدام Grunt هي - يمكن لـ Grunt أداء المهام المتكررة بسهولة شديدة ، مثل التجميع واختبار الوحدة وتقليل الملفات وتشغيل الاختبارات وما إلى ذلك.
يتضمن Grunt مهامًا مدمجة تعمل على توسيع وظائف المكونات الإضافية والبرامج النصية الخاصة بك.
النظام البيئي لـ Grunt ضخم ؛ يمكنك أتمتة أي شيء بجهد أقل.

المطبوع

TypeScript هي لغة مكتوبة بشدة ، وموجهة للكائنات ، ومترجمة. تم تصميمه بواسطة Anders Hejlsberg (مصمم C #) في Microsoft. TypeScript هي لغة ومجموعة من الأدوات في نفس الوقت. TypeScript هي مجموعة مكتوبة من JavaScript مجمعة إلى JavaScript. بمعنى آخر ، TypeScript هو JavaScript بالإضافة إلى بعض الميزات الإضافية.

مسج

jQuery هي مكتبة JavaScript مصممة لتبسيط اجتياز شجرة HTML DOM ومعالجتها ، بالإضافة إلى معالجة الأحداث والرسوم المتحركة CSS و Ajax. إنه برنامج مجاني مفتوح المصدر يستخدم رخصة MIT المسموح بها. اعتبارًا من مايو 2019 ، يتم استخدام jQuery بواسطة 73٪ من أكثر 10 ملايين موقع إلكتروني شعبية ، وهي مكتبة جافا سكريبت خفيفة الوزن ، "اكتب أقل ، أنجز المزيد". الغرض من jQuery هو تسهيل استخدام JavaScript على موقع الويب الخاص بك. يأخذ jQuery الكثير من المهام الشائعة التي تتطلب العديد من سطور تعليمات JavaScript البرمجية لإنجازها ، وتلفها في طرق يمكنك الاتصال بها بسطر واحد من التعليمات البرمجية.

التمهيد

Bootstrap هو إطار عمل CSS مجاني ومفتوح المصدر موجه نحو تطوير الويب المتجاوب على الهاتف المحمول. يحتوي على قوالب تصميم تستند إلى CSS و JavaScript للطباعة والنماذج والأزرار والتنقل ومكونات الواجهة الأخرى. تتكيف CSS المتجاوبة مع Bootstrap مع الهواتف والأجهزة اللوحية وأجهزة سطح المكتب. تعد أنماط Mobile first جزءًا من إطار عمل Bootstrap. Bootstrap متوافق مع جميع المتصفحات الحديثة مما يجعله أداة تطوير الويب الأكثر استخدامًا من قبل المطورين.